mirror of
https://github.com/JasonYANG170/IOTConnect-Web.git
synced 2024-12-03 17:16:33 +00:00
90 lines
4.3 KiB
Markdown
90 lines
4.3 KiB
Markdown
# vue-router [![release candidate](https://img.shields.io/npm/v/vue-router.svg)](https://www.npmjs.com/package/vue-router) [![test](https://github.com/vuejs/router/actions/workflows/test.yml/badge.svg)](https://github.com/vuejs/router/actions/workflows/test.yml)
|
|
|
|
> - This is the repository for Vue Router 4 (for Vue 3)
|
|
> - For Vue Router 3 (for Vue 2) see [vuejs/vue-router](https://github.com/vuejs/vue-router).
|
|
|
|
<h2 align="center">Supporting Vue Router</h2>
|
|
|
|
Vue Router is part of the Vue Ecosystem and is an MIT-licensed open source project with its ongoing development made possible entirely by the support of Sponsors. If you would like to become a sponsor, please consider:
|
|
|
|
- [Become a Sponsor on GitHub](https://github.com/sponsors/posva)
|
|
- [One-time donation via PayPal](https://paypal.me/posva)
|
|
|
|
<!--sponsors start-->
|
|
|
|
<h4 align="center">Silver Sponsors</h4>
|
|
<p align="center">
|
|
<a href="https://www.vuemastery.com/" target="_blank" rel="noopener noreferrer">
|
|
<picture>
|
|
<source srcset="https://posva-sponsors.pages.dev/logos/vuemastery-dark.png" media="(prefers-color-scheme: dark)" height="42px" alt="VueMastery" />
|
|
<img src="https://posva-sponsors.pages.dev/logos/vuemastery-light.svg" height="42px" alt="VueMastery" />
|
|
</picture>
|
|
</a>
|
|
<a href="https://www.prefect.io/" target="_blank" rel="noopener noreferrer">
|
|
<picture>
|
|
<source srcset="https://posva-sponsors.pages.dev/logos/prefectlogo-dark.svg" media="(prefers-color-scheme: dark)" height="42px" alt="Prefect" />
|
|
<img src="https://posva-sponsors.pages.dev/logos/prefectlogo-light.svg" height="42px" alt="Prefect" />
|
|
</picture>
|
|
</a>
|
|
</p>
|
|
|
|
<h4 align="center">Bronze Sponsors</h4>
|
|
<p align="center">
|
|
<a href="https://stormier.ninja" target="_blank" rel="noopener noreferrer">
|
|
<picture>
|
|
<source srcset="https://avatars.githubusercontent.com/u/2486424?u=7b0c73ae5d090ce53bf59473094e9606fe082c59&v=4" media="(prefers-color-scheme: dark)" height="26px" alt="Stanislas Ormières" />
|
|
<img src="https://avatars.githubusercontent.com/u/2486424?u=7b0c73ae5d090ce53bf59473094e9606fe082c59&v=4" height="26px" alt="Stanislas Ormières" />
|
|
</picture>
|
|
</a>
|
|
<a href="https://www.vuejs.de" target="_blank" rel="noopener noreferrer">
|
|
<picture>
|
|
<source srcset="https://avatars.githubusercontent.com/u/4183726?u=6b50a8ea16de29d2982f43c5640b1db9299ebcd1&v=4" media="(prefers-color-scheme: dark)" height="26px" alt="Antony Konstantinidis" />
|
|
<img src="https://avatars.githubusercontent.com/u/4183726?u=6b50a8ea16de29d2982f43c5640b1db9299ebcd1&v=4" height="26px" alt="Antony Konstantinidis" />
|
|
</picture>
|
|
</a>
|
|
<a href="https://storyblok.com" target="_blank" rel="noopener noreferrer">
|
|
<picture>
|
|
<source srcset="https://posva-sponsors.pages.dev/logos/storyblok.png" media="(prefers-color-scheme: dark)" height="26px" alt="Storyblok" />
|
|
<img src="https://posva-sponsors.pages.dev/logos/storyblok.png" height="26px" alt="Storyblok" />
|
|
</picture>
|
|
</a>
|
|
<a href="https://ui.nuxt.com/pro" target="_blank" rel="noopener noreferrer">
|
|
<picture>
|
|
<source srcset="https://avatars.githubusercontent.com/u/81570812?v=4" media="(prefers-color-scheme: dark)" height="26px" alt="Nuxt UI Pro Templates" />
|
|
<img src="https://avatars.githubusercontent.com/u/81570812?v=4" height="26px" alt="Nuxt UI Pro Templates" />
|
|
</picture>
|
|
</a>
|
|
</p>
|
|
|
|
<!--sponsors end-->
|
|
|
|
---
|
|
|
|
Get started with the [documentation](https://router.vuejs.org).
|
|
|
|
## Quickstart
|
|
|
|
- Via CDN: `<script src="https://unpkg.com/vue-router@4"></script>`
|
|
- In-browser playground on [CodeSandbox](https://codesandbox.io/s/vue-router-4-reproduction-hb9lh)
|
|
- Add it to an existing Vue Project:
|
|
|
|
```bash
|
|
npm install vue-router@4
|
|
```
|
|
|
|
## Changes from Vue Router 3
|
|
|
|
Please consult the [Migration Guide](https://router.vuejs.org/guide/migration/).
|
|
|
|
## Contributing
|
|
|
|
See [Contributing Guide](https://github.com/vuejs/router/blob/main/.github/contributing.md).
|
|
|
|
## Special Thanks
|
|
|
|
<a href="https://www.browserstack.com">
|
|
<img src="https://github.com/vuejs/vue-router/raw/dev/assets/browserstack-logo-600x315.png" height="80" title="BrowserStack Logo" alt="BrowserStack Logo" />
|
|
</a>
|
|
|
|
Special thanks to [BrowserStack](https://www.browserstack.com) for letting the maintainers use their service to debug browser specific issues.
|